Home
last modified time | relevance | path

Searched refs:beep_mask (Results 1 – 7 of 7) sorted by relevance

/linux-4.4.14/Documentation/hwmon/
Dw83791d93 method of a single sysfs beep_mask file to a newer method using multiple
104 responsible for handling the fact that the alarms and beep_mask bitmaps
135 Alarms bitmap vs. beep_mask bitmask
137 For legacy code using the alarms and beep_mask files:
139 in0 (VCORE) : alarms: 0x000001 beep_mask: 0x000001
140 in1 (VINR0) : alarms: 0x000002 beep_mask: 0x002000 <== mismatch
141 in2 (+3.3VIN): alarms: 0x000004 beep_mask: 0x000004
142 in3 (5VDD) : alarms: 0x000008 beep_mask: 0x000008
143 in4 (+12VIN) : alarms: 0x000100 beep_mask: 0x000100
144 in5 (-12VIN) : alarms: 0x000200 beep_mask: 0x000200
[all …]
Dsysfs-interface683 beep_mask Bitmask for beep.
/linux-4.4.14/drivers/hwmon/
Dgl518sm.c137 u8 beep_mask; /* Register value */ member
175 data->beep_mask = gl518_read_value(client, GL518_REG_ALARM); in gl518_update_device()
264 show(BEEP_MASK, beep_mask, beep_mask);
350 set(BEEP_MASK, beep_mask, beep_mask, GL518_REG_ALARM);
373 data->beep_mask = gl518_read_value(client, GL518_REG_ALARM); in set_fan_min()
378 data->beep_mask &= data->alarm_mask; in set_fan_min()
379 gl518_write_value(client, GL518_REG_ALARM, data->beep_mask); in set_fan_min()
459 static DEVICE_ATTR(beep_mask, S_IWUSR|S_IRUGO,
483 return sprintf(buf, "%u\n", (data->beep_mask >> bitnr) & 1); in show_beep()
503 data->beep_mask = gl518_read_value(client, GL518_REG_ALARM); in set_beep()
[all …]
Dgl520sm.c98 u8 beep_mask; member
136 data->beep_mask = gl520_read_value(client, GL520_REG_BEEP_MASK); in gl520_update_device()
418 data->beep_mask = gl520_read_value(client, GL520_REG_BEEP_MASK); in set_fan_min()
423 data->beep_mask &= data->alarm_mask; in set_fan_min()
424 gl520_write_value(client, GL520_REG_BEEP_MASK, data->beep_mask); in set_fan_min()
617 return sprintf(buf, "%d\n", data->beep_mask); in get_beep_mask()
658 data->beep_mask = r; in set_beep_mask()
667 static DEVICE_ATTR(beep_mask, S_IRUGO | S_IWUSR,
695 return sprintf(buf, "%d\n", (data->beep_mask >> bitnr) & 1); in get_beep()
715 data->beep_mask = gl520_read_value(client, GL520_REG_BEEP_MASK); in set_beep()
[all …]
Dw83791d.c326 u32 beep_mask; /* Mask off specific beeps */ member
453 return sprintf(buf, "%d\n", (data->beep_mask >> bitnr) & 1); in show_beep()
476 data->beep_mask &= ~(0xff << (bytenr * 8)); in store_beep()
477 data->beep_mask |= w83791d_read(client, W83791D_REG_BEEP_CTRL[bytenr]) in store_beep()
480 data->beep_mask &= ~(1 << bitnr); in store_beep()
481 data->beep_mask |= val << bitnr; in store_beep()
484 (data->beep_mask >> (bytenr * 8)) & 0xff); in store_beep()
1069 return sprintf(buf, "%d\n", BEEP_MASK_FROM_REG(data->beep_mask)); in show_beep_mask()
1093 data->beep_mask = BEEP_MASK_TO_REG(val) & ~GLOBAL_BEEP_ENABLE_MASK; in store_beep_mask()
1094 data->beep_mask |= (data->beep_enable << GLOBAL_BEEP_ENABLE_SHIFT); in store_beep_mask()
[all …]
Dw83781d.c239 u32 beep_mask; /* Register encoding, combined */ member
499 (long)BEEP_MASK_FROM_REG(data->beep_mask, data->type)); in show_beep_mask()
515 data->beep_mask &= 0x8000; /* preserve beep enable */ in store_beep_mask()
516 data->beep_mask |= BEEP_MASK_TO_REG(val, data->type); in store_beep_mask()
518 data->beep_mask & 0xff); in store_beep_mask()
520 (data->beep_mask >> 8) & 0xff); in store_beep_mask()
523 ((data->beep_mask) >> 16) & 0xff); in store_beep_mask()
530 static DEVICE_ATTR(beep_mask, S_IRUGO | S_IWUSR,
538 return sprintf(buf, "%u\n", (data->beep_mask >> bitnr) & 1); in show_beep()
560 data->beep_mask |= (1 << bitnr); in store_beep()
[all …]
Dw83627hf.c379 u32 beep_mask; /* Register encoding, combined */ member
867 (long)BEEP_MASK_FROM_REG(data->beep_mask)); in show_beep_mask()
885 data->beep_mask = (data->beep_mask & 0x8000) in store_beep_mask()
888 data->beep_mask & 0xff); in store_beep_mask()
890 ((data->beep_mask) >> 16) & 0xff); in store_beep_mask()
892 (data->beep_mask >> 8) & 0xff); in store_beep_mask()
898 static DEVICE_ATTR(beep_mask, S_IRUGO | S_IWUSR,
906 return sprintf(buf, "%u\n", (data->beep_mask >> bitnr) & 1); in show_beep()
928 data->beep_mask |= (1 << bitnr); in store_beep()
930 data->beep_mask &= ~(1 << bitnr); in store_beep()
[all …]